Cyber-attacks, especially phishing attacks were studied, and a phishing attack model was established. A model of secure mobile terminal browsing service and the updating policy of phishing URL blacklist were designed. The details of secure browsing service, the client/server communication protocols and the data structures were described. This part is the important foundation to achieve a secure browser application. On the basis of secure browsing protocol, a complete secure browser application was implemented.
